projects
/
physics.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
2c18685
)
made all the balls start moving
author
Patrik Gornicz
<Gornicz.P@gmail.com>
Sat, 2 Aug 2008 01:12:29 +0000
(21:12 -0400)
committer
Patrik Gornicz
<Gornicz.P@gmail.com>
Sat, 2 Aug 2008 01:12:29 +0000
(21:12 -0400)
src/entityCreator.cpp
patch
|
blob
|
blame
|
history
diff --git
a/src/entityCreator.cpp
b/src/entityCreator.cpp
index
8ed35f4
..
078e40f
100644
(file)
--- a/
src/entityCreator.cpp
+++ b/
src/entityCreator.cpp
@@
-19,47
+19,55
@@
void creator::init()
ball = new Ball(Vector2(50, 50), 20, cWhite);
ball = new Ball(Vector2(50, 50), 20, cWhite);
- ball->applyImpulse(Vector2(0.
01,0.01
)),
+ ball->applyImpulse(Vector2(0.
25,0.05
)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 50), 20, cBlack);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 50), 20, cBlack);
+ ball->applyImpulse(Vector2(-0.15,-0.05)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 50), 20, cGrey);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 50), 20, cGrey);
+ ball->applyImpulse(Vector2(0.25,0.15)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(50, 100), 20, cRed);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(50, 100), 20, cRed);
+ ball->applyImpulse(Vector2(0.35,-0.15)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 100), 20, cGreen);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 100), 20, cGreen);
+ ball->applyImpulse(Vector2(-0.15,0.05)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 100), 20, cBlue);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 100), 20, cBlue);
+ ball->applyImpulse(Vector2(0.25,0.15)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(50, 150), 20, cYellow);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(50, 150), 20, cYellow);
+ ball->applyImpulse(Vector2(0.25,-0.05)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 150), 20, cMagenta);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(100, 150), 20, cMagenta);
+ ball->applyImpulse(Vector2(-0.15,-0.05)),
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 150), 20, cCyan);
Balls.push(ball);
manager::add(ball);
ball = new Ball(Vector2(150, 150), 20, cCyan);
+ ball->applyImpulse(Vector2(-0.15,0.05)),
Balls.push(ball);
manager::add(ball);
}
Balls.push(ball);
manager::add(ball);
}